
Two technical college students were chased and shot at by rival motorcyclists near Nida Intersection on Seri Thai Road, resulting in two injuries. Meanwhile, a local resident was hit by stray bullets and injured as well.
At 15:50 on 8 Jan 2026, Police Lieutenant Colonel Trinet Suwannang, Deputy Inspector (Investigation) of Bueng Kum Police Station, received reports of youths riding motorcycles chasing and shooting at each other with multiple injuries near Nida Intersection on Seri Thai Road inbound, Khlong Kum Subdistrict, Bueng Kum District, Bangkok. He, along with Police Major General Kampanat Arunkiriroj, Commander of Metropolitan Police Division 4; Police Colonel Sanya Ubonviratna, Superintendent of Bueng Kum Police Station; Police Colonel Thanyaphat Boonsuk, Superintendent of Investigation Division of Metropolitan Police Division 4; forensic officers; and volunteers from Siam Ruam Jai Foundation, went to investigate.
At the scene, a white Toyota Cross registered in Bangkok was found with two bullet holes on the left front door and one hole on the window glass. The driver, 42-year-old Rujiraporn Joysaengsri, was hit by glass shards on her left arm and was sent to Ramkhamhaeng Hospital.
Also found was a red Honda PCX motorcycle without a license plate with two passengers. The first, 18-year-old Paphakon, was shot twice—once grazing his neck and once on the head—with an unknown caliber firearm and was injured. The second, 17-year-old Phoraphat, was shot once in the right arm with an unknown caliber firearm and injured. Both were taken to Nopparat Hospital. The driver, known as Boy (a pseudonym), aged 16, was not injured.
Boy, a friend of the injured, said they and their friends are technical college students riding three motorcycles with a total of seven people. The motorcycle that was shot had three riders. They were traveling from Minburi toward Nida Intersection when approximately four people on two motorcycles approached and fired unknown firearms at them, injuring some of his group. A local sedan driver traveling alongside them was also injured by stray bullets. The perpetrators fled toward Ban Ma Intersection.
Authorities will initially review CCTV footage from the scene to track down the suspects and proceed with legal action.
